19th December 2025 – (Kabul) A magnitude 5.7 earthquake struck the Hindu Kush mountain region of northern Afghanistan on Friday morning, sending tremors through the capital Kabul and nearby provinces. The quake occurred at 10.04am local time, according to the German Research Centre for Geosciences. Initial reports indicated a shallow event typical of the seismically active Hindu Kush, prompting concern among residents who felt sustained shaking.
There were no immediate reports of casualties or major damage. Authorities and monitoring agencies continued to assess the impact across the affected areas.
